WebO-ring seal configurations are categorized as either axial or radial. Radial seals have squeeze applied to the inside and outside diameters and typically consist of a piston or a rod. Axial seals have squeeze applied to the top and bottom of the O-ring cross-section and the applications are defined as having internal or external pressure.
